Conversations with Carl Hulle

Today we’d like to introduce you to Carl Hulle.

Carl Hulle

Hi Carl, so excited to have you with us today. What can you tell us about your story?
I was always trying to scratch a creative itch, whether it was photography, drawing, graphic design, writing poems, or making clothes. Once I stumbled upon screenprinting with a class my highschool offered, I realized that my creativity can be something that I can make a living off of. I’ve been off to the races ever since then starting several clothing businesses. After 3 failed attempts I have found one that works in the 4th attempt. Second Chance Clothing & Creations ( SC3 for short) is a perfect blend of what I wanted my first 3 businesses to be without the lies and headaches. It’s just me, myself, and I putting in the work but that way, all the work can get done and at the pace that I know it can be pushed to. Screenprinting and embroidery is something I love to do and I’m so happy that with SC3 I get to share my love with the world around me.

Alright, so let’s dig a little deeper into the story – has it been an easy path overall and if not, what were the challenges you’ve had to overcome?
It has not been a smooth road. The first clothing business I started, the ownership was stolen from me. I made the business, business model, name, logo, everything… but my business partner at the time got an LLC and only put his name on it effectively stealing 100% of the ownership for himself. The very next clothing business I was apart of I was being led on with false promises of ownership. And the third clothing business I was apart of didn’t honor a verbal agreement of ownership we had. Although the road to my current successes hasn’t been smooth, I am grateful for all of my “bad apples” because they have provided me with valuable lessons to learn from and I wouldn’t be where I am today had I not learned those harsh lessons.

As you know, we’re big fans of you and your work. For our readers who might not be as familiar what can you tell them about what you do?
I specialize in embroidery, screenprinting, photography, graphic design, videography, and I also do custom work aswell. I am most proud of the fact that I am operating SC3 100% myself, nobody can take that away from me. What sets me apart from others is my ability to screenprint AND embroider, as well as providing options for custom embroidery/screenprinting/and design work. I film most of my work and make videos out of the footage for my Instagram/tiktok/youtube

What matters most to you? Why?
What matters to me most is showing the world that whatever your deepest passion in life is, there is a way to turn your passion into something that can provide for you financially. You don’t have to cast your passion to the way side and play it safe or join the rat-race. If you find what you love to do, just keep doing it in whatever capacity you can and if you stay consistent it will happen eventually. I am living proof.
